About Bryan County
Bryan County along Georgia's coast south of Savannah features low-lying terrain with sandy soils, tidal marshes, and high water tables that create significant challenges for septic system installation. Many properties require advanced treatment units, low-profile chambers, or mound systems to maintain adequate separation from groundwater. Wells must be carefully sited to avoid saltwater intrusion from the nearby coast, and water testing for chlorides is essential.

How often do I need septic pumping?
- The frequency depends on your system type and household usage. For most Bryan County homeowners, professionals recommend scheduling septic pumping every 3–5 years, though annual inspections can help catch issues early.
